One of the primary responsibilities of a pensions specialist is to assess an individual’s current financial situation and determine the most suitable pension scheme for them. This involves evaluating various factors, such as income, age, retirement goals, and risk tolerance. By considering these factors, a pensions specialist can recommend the most appropriate pension plan that ensures both financial security and growth.
Furthermore, pensions specialists also play a crucial role in advising individuals on investment strategies within their pension plans. They consider the risk appetite of their clients and help them build a diversified investment portfolio that maximizes returns while minimizing potential risks. This might involve selecting a mix of asset classes, such as stocks, bonds, and real estate investments, that align with the individual’s risk profile and long-term financial goals.
